> I don't know. Till now all the problem cases have been isolated to a
> specific controller / drive combination (sata_promise and newer seagate
> drives) or hardware configuration problem (most of them being PSU
> issues), so I don't think we need such option yet. If you have a
> problematic hardware which pukes on 3.0Gbps, libata should do the right
> thing after complaining a bit which IMHO isn't too bad.
So, loss of data or data corruption can't occur, even when we have to
wait until the speed is limited?
